BRISTOL, Tenn. – The King University men's volleyball team dropped their Conference Carolinas contest, 3-0 to Erskine Saturday evening.
Colton Bueter had 14 kills for the Tornado, while
Alex Barkley had 11.
THE BASICS
FINAL SCORE: Erskine 3, King 0 (21-25, 19-25, 22-25)
LOCATION: Student Center Complex; Bristol, Tenn.

INSIDE THE BOX SCORE
- Bueter led all players with 14 kills, with Barkley adding 11, along with a pair of service aces.
- JP Ribeiro had 27 assists on the night for the Tornado.
FOR THE FOES
- Pablo Zamar had 13 kills to lead the Flying Fleet attack, while Aidon Love had 10.
- Gino Briglio had 38 assists on the night.
